Track Preparations at Churchill Downs

The condition of the Churchill Downs track is paramount to a fair and exciting Kentucky Derby. Maintaining this renowned racing surface requires meticulous attention to detail.

Maintaining the Track

The Churchill Downs track is a carefully curated blend of soil types, designed to provide optimal racing conditions. The team works tirelessly to ensure the track is perfect for the big race.

  • Soil Composition: A precise mix of clay, sand, and silt is used, constantly monitored for moisture and consistency.
  • Grooming Techniques: Specialized machinery meticulously levels and grooms the track, removing any imperfections and ensuring a smooth, even surface.
  • Watering Schedule: A precise watering schedule is followed to maintain the ideal level of moisture in the soil, crucial for preventing injuries and ensuring fair racing. This process takes into account weather forecasts and soil analysis. The goal is to create a "Churchill Downs track" that's known for its consistent quality. Safety Measures

The safety of both horses and jockeys is of utmost importance at Churchill Downs. Extensive safety protocols are in place to mitigate any potential risks.

  • Emergency Services: A dedicated team of paramedics and veterinary professionals are on-site throughout the event, ready to respond to any emergencies.
  • Veterinary Care: A state-of-the-art veterinary facility is available at Churchill Downs, equipped to handle any equine medical needs.
  • Track Inspections: Regular inspections of the track are conducted to identify and address any potential hazards before they become problems. Security and Crowd Management

Managing the huge crowds that attend the Kentucky Derby requires a robust security plan. Churchill Downs employs a comprehensive strategy to ensure a safe and enjoyable event for everyone.

  • Security Personnel: Hundreds of security personnel are deployed throughout the grounds, working to maintain order and prevent any incidents.
  • Crowd Control Strategies: Signage, barriers, and trained personnel guide the flow of foot traffic, minimizing congestion.
  • Emergency Exits: Numerous clearly marked emergency exits are available, ensuring the swift and safe evacuation of the grounds in case of emergency. Horse Training and Conditioning

The horses undergo a rigorous training regimen in the lead-up to the Derby. Every detail is carefully considered to ensure peak performance.

  • Workouts: Intense yet controlled workouts are performed to maintain fitness and refine racing strategies.
  • Dietary Adjustments: Dietary plans are carefully designed to optimize the horses' energy levels and overall health.

Jockey Preparations

The jockeys play a vital role in the outcome of the Kentucky Derby, and their preparations are equally rigorous.

  • Weight Management: Jockeys meticulously manage their weight to meet the required riding weight for their assigned horses.
  • Riding Practice: Jockeys spend hours practicing their riding techniques and strategizing race plans.
  • Race Strategy Discussions: Jockeys work closely with their trainers to develop strategies for the race.
